Now, let's talk about "how to get there from here"! If you will be starting at Disney's Pop Century Resort, the easiest way in my opinion is to take the Disney Skyliner to EPCOT. The Disney Skyliner will take you to the EPCOT International Gateway entrance where there is a Disney Skyliner station located. Once you exit the Disney Skyliner station at EPCOT, you can then walk to Disney's BoardWalk or take a quick boat ride to the area.Please note, that after you get on the first Disney Skyliner gondola at Disney's Pop Century Resort, you will then transfer to another gondola at Disney's Caribbean Beach Resort since this area is the "hub" for the Disney Skyliner system. It's a quick and easy process, just follow the signage or ask a helpful Cast Member nearby for instructions.

Do Disney buses go to the BoardWalk? ›

From Magic Kingdom or Disney's Animal Kingdom, you can catch a bus to Disney's BoardWalk Inn or Villas. However, if you are at EPCOT or Disney's Hollywood Studios, Disney's BoardWalk is accessible via boat or walking!

Does the Skyliner go directly from Pop Century to Hollywood Studios? ›

Remember, if you are going to Hollywood Studios and traveling from Disney's Pop Century, Art of Animation, Riviera, or an EPCOT resort, you'll have to change tracks at the Caribbean Beach Skyliner Station. That means you'll have to wait in a second line.

Where does Disney Skyliner go from Pop Century? ›

What Resorts and Theme Parks Are on the Skyliner? The Skyliner connects two theme parks—Epcot and Disney's Hollywood Studios to four resorts: Caribbean Beach, Pop Century, Art of Animation, and Riviera Resort. Pop Century Resort and Art of Animation Resort share a single station between the two hotels.
